Building a Life Together: The US Spousal Sponsorship Process
Embarking on a journey of love often involves navigating complex legal matters. For individuals who desire to build a life together in the United States, spousal sponsorship presents a legitimate option. This process, governed by US immigration regulations, allows a US citizen or copyright to sponsor their foreign significant other for a copyright, paving the way for lawful residency.
- Comprehending the Eligibility Criteria: The first step involves carefully reviewing the eligibility requirements for both the sponsor and the petitioner seeking sponsorship.
- Gathering Essential Documentation: A comprehensive collection of documents is required, including proof of bond, financial stability, and legal residency status.
- Submitting the Petition: The legally binding petition process involves filing Form I-130 with US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S).
- Supporting the Application: After submission of the petition, the USCIS will review the application and may inquire about additional documentation or interviews.
- Modifying to US Residency: Upon approval of the sponsorship, the foreign individual can then apply for a copyright and adjust their status to lawful copyright in the United States.
